I have back pedal style breaks. They are very loose, and so it takes
a while to stop (have almost died many times because i couldn't stop
in time). Does anyone know how to tighten these breaks? I tried to
search the internet for a link on this, but to no avail.

Thanks for any help!
julia


Your "brakes" are commonly called "coaster brakes". Here's some
instructions on how to rebuild the hub:
http://www.parktool.com/repair_help/coaster.shtml

It may be that you simply need to tighten the bearing cones. However,
there may be a spring broken within the hub. Or there may be worn
internal parts. Without seeing the bike in person, it's not possible
to tell.
